Where can I find a reliable Kia repair shop near Brimson, MN?

Given Brimson's rural location, the closest specialized Kia service is at the Duluth Kia dealership, approximately 45 minutes north. For general repairs, trusted independent shops in nearby towns like Two Harbors or Cloquet are your best local options, many of which have experience with Kia models common to our area.

Are Kia repairs more expensive in our rural area compared to larger cities?

Labor rates may be slightly lower than in the Twin Cities, but parts availability can cause delays and sometimes higher costs due to shipping to our remote location. It's always wise to get a detailed estimate upfront and ask about the parts sourcing process to avoid surprises.

What are the most common Kia repair issues for drivers in Brimson's climate?

Harsh winters and gravel roads commonly lead to issues with suspension components, brakes (due to road salt corrosion), and undercarriage damage. For many Kia models, ensuring the engine block heater is functional and addressing any factory service campaigns for cold-weather starting are also critical local considerations.

How do I know if my Kia needs immediate service or if it can wait for a trip to Duluth?

For safety-critical warnings like brake failure, check engine lights with noticeable performance loss, or overheating, seek immediate local assistance. For routine maintenance or non-urgent recalls, it's practical to schedule service in Duluth to ensure access to specialized tools and factory-trained technicians.

What should I look for in a local mechanic to work on my Kia?

Look for a shop that uses up-to-date diagnostic software compatible with Kia's systems and has positive reviews from other import car owners. Given our distance from dealers, a shop with strong part supplier relationships for timely repairs is invaluable. Always verify they have experience with your specific Kia model year.
